2024 Hajj: Former Grand Khadi Calls for Proper Investigation of NAHCON Officials Over Alleged Fraud, Says Some Pilgrims Received $200 instead of $500

By Omowumi Omotosho

 

 

A former Grand Khadi of the Kwara State Shariah Court of Appeal Justice Idris Haroon, has called on the federal government to conduct a thorough investigation into the alleged mismanagement of funds by officials of the National Hajj Commission of Nigeria (NAHCON) during the 2024 Hajj operation.

Haroon emphasized that, although the issue is still under review, any officials found guilty in the scandal should face consequences, given the seriousness of the matter.

The highly respected retired judge made these remarks during a live radio interview in Ilorin, the state capital.

He expressed his dismay that, as a guest of the King of Saudi Arabia during the recent Hajj, several pilgrims confided in him that they received only $200 instead of the $500 they were promised as travel allowances.

“This matter is yet to be decided, but I want it to be thoroughly investigated, and whoever is found to be part of this act of dishonesty that caused suffering to our pilgrims should not be spared,” Haroon stated.

He continued, “I was in Makkah during the last pilgrimage as a guest of King Salman of the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, and some pilgrims confessed to me that many of them were only given $200 instead of $500, and when they got to Saudi, they were only given the equivalent of $200 in Riyal. That was how they took money from pilgrims. It is embarrassing that people who travel to serve God will be the ones who violate God’s law. You must be just and transparent.”

Haroon also urged the new NAHCON Chairman, Prof. Abdullahi Sale Uthman, “to return sanity to the commission and know that he is representing the entire Muslim community with successes of the job preoccupying his mind rather than pecuniary gain.”

Justice Haroon’s statements have added pressure on the federal government and NAHCON to ensure accountability in the handling of funds associated with the Hajj, a sacred journey for millions of Muslims around the world. The public now awaits further developments as the investigation progresses.
